新闻中心

css list-style-position与list-style-type组合使用

2025-10-06
浏览次数:
返回列表
list-style-type 设置列表标记样式如 disc、square、decimal;2. list-style-position 控制标记位置为 inside 或 outside;3. 二者可组合使用,等价于 list-style 简写;4. 实际排版中 inside 使文本与标记同行,outside 则缩进对齐更清晰;5. 可结合 margin 和 padding 调整布局。

css list-style-position与list-style-type组合使用

在CSS中,list-style-positionlist-style-type 可以组合使用,来控制列表项标记的类型和位置。它们都属于列表样式的一部分,通常应用于 ulol 元素内的 li 项目。

list-style-type 的作用

这个属性定义列表项标记(即前面的小点或数字)的样式类型。

常见取值包括:
  • disc:实心圆(默认,用于无序列表)
  • circle:空心圆
  • square:实心方块
  • decimal:阿拉伯数字(默认,用于有序列表)
  • none:不显示标记

list-style-position 的作用

这个属性决定标记符号相对于列表项内容的位置。

主要取值有:
  • inside:标记位于列表项内容内部,文本与标记在同一视觉行内
  • outside:标记位于列表项外部(默认),通常在内容左边留出空间放置标记

组合使用方式

你可以分别设置这两个属性,也可以用简写属性 list-style 一次性定义。

例如,分别设置:

li {
  list-style-type: square;
  list-style-position: inside;
}

等价于使用简写:

青泥AI 青泥AI

青泥学术AI写作辅助平台

青泥AI 360 查看详情 青泥AI
li {
  list-style: square inside;
}

如果还想加上图片作为标记,还可以加入 list-style-image,比如:

li {
  list-style: square inside url("bullet.png");
}

实际效果差异示例

当使用 inside 时,长文本会从标记后开始并可能换行对齐文本首行;而 outside 下,换行文本会缩进以对齐标记后的空间,排版更清晰但受外边距影响较大。

建议在设计导航菜单或自定义列表样式时,根据布局需求选择合适组合,必要时用 marginpadding 调整间距。

基本上就这些,灵活搭配能让列表更符合页面设计需求。不复杂但容易忽略细节。

以上就是css list-style-position与list-style-type组合使用的详细内容,更多请关注其它相关文章!


# 列表样式  # 中不  # 更清晰  # 两种类型  # 选择器  # 还可以  # 你可以  # 可以用  # 相关文章  # 这两个  # css  # 中文网  # 在线网站优化最好的方法  # 云南抖音推广网站排行榜  # 网站因为seo被黑  # 贵港网站建设 鱼刺系统  # 陕西企业抖音seo技巧  # Seo泛目录解析  # 芙蓉区快手营销推广中心  # 乳山网站优化公司招聘  # 山东家具网站建设  # 营销推广面试考题汇总 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: 响应式图片在网页设计中的正确实现方法  C++ vector二维数组定义_C++ vector of vector用法  AO3中文官网链接_AO3网页版稳定镜像站  支付宝如何管理隐私设置_支付宝隐私保护的配置技巧  Yandex浏览器官方网页版入口 Yandex浏览器最新版官网  UC浏览器网页版登录入口官网 电脑版网址入口  Excel Power Pivot如何处理XML数据源 构建高级数据模型  J*a 递归快速排序中静态变量的状态管理与陷阱  Excel中VLOOKUP的第四个参数是干什么用的_Excel VLOOKUP第四参数作用解析  PHP中高效并行检查多链接状态的教程  Golang如何优化内存分配与垃圾回收_Golang内存管理与GC优化实践  在J*a中如何使用Stream.map转换元素_Stream映射操作解析  从OpenAI API响应中高效提取生成文本  学习通网页版快速入口 学习通官网网页版直接打开  vivo浏览器自带的下载器速度慢怎么办 vivo浏览器提升文件下载速度的技巧  想当下一个《2077》?《心之眼》Steam评价升至"多半好评"  Win10文件资源管理器“此电脑”分组怎么关 Win10恢复经典视图【技巧】  天猫2025双十一0点秒杀攻略 天猫爆款抢购时间  深入理解J*aScript Promise异步执行与微任务队列  铁路12306改签能改到更早的车次吗_铁路12306改签提前车次规则  PHP高效扁平化嵌套数组:使用array_merge与数组解包操作符  Golang如何使用context实现超时取消_Golang context超时取消模式实践  Go语言中动态执行代码字符串的策略与实践  Animex动漫社网入口地址 Animex动漫社网正版在线入口  b站赚钱渠道_b站收益来源  Golang如何实现状态模式管理对象状态_Golang State模式实现技巧  163邮箱登录密码 163邮箱忘记密码找回  KFC套餐升级怎么获取优惠代码_KFC套餐升级活动与优惠代码获取方法  J*aScript中向JSON对象添加新属性的正确姿势  J*aScript类型检查_j*ascript代码规范  在Qt QML中通过Python字典动态更新TextEdit内容的教程  Mac怎么查看崩溃日志_Mac控制台错误报告分析  如何创建独立于主系统的J*a运行环境_隔离式环境搭建策略  sublime怎么设置启动时打开的窗口_sublime会话管理与热退出  Mac怎么使用表情符号_Mac Emoji快捷键面板  批改网学生版PC登录 批改网官网登录系统入口  QQ邮箱网页版入口 QQ邮箱官方邮箱登录通道  深入理解J*a编译器的兼容性选项:从-source到--release  css链接悬停下划线样式如何自定义_使用::after结合content和transition  从J*aScript对象中精确提取指定属性的教程  QQ邮箱在线使用入口 QQ邮箱个人账号网页版登录  c++如何使用Catch2编写单元测试_c++简洁易用的BDD风格测试框架  探索高级语言到原生C/C++的转译:挑战与内存管理策略  c++如何使用Meson构建系统_c++比CMake更快的构建工具  腾讯视频怎么使用多账号家庭管理_腾讯视频家庭多账号统一管理与权限分配教程  Node.js CSV 数据处理:基于字段值条件过滤整条记录的策略  优化 Jest 模拟:强制未实现函数抛出错误以提升测试效率  优化Log4j2控制台输出性能:解决异步日志瓶颈  J*a里如何使用N*igableMap进行导航操作_可导航Map操作技巧解析  AO3网页版最新入口合集 Archive of Our Own在线访问指南 

搜索